Sunbury moves forward on municipal building lower-level renovation and street inspection contract; Columbus Street parking lot work scheduled
Summary
Council approved construction inspection services for the 2025 street improvement program (DLZ) and received readings on awarding the municipal building lower-level renovation contract to Setterin and a parking-lot project with Environmental Design Group. Finance committee reported projects were below budget and contractors selected.
The Sunbury City Council on June 28 approved a resolution to contract construction administration and inspection services with DLZ for the 2025 street improvement program and heard readings related to the municipal building lower-level renovation and the Columbus Street parking-lot project.
